900字范文,内容丰富有趣,生活中的好帮手!
900字范文 > C语言字符串读取(详解C语言中字符串的输入和读取方法) – 网络

C语言字符串读取(详解C语言中字符串的输入和读取方法) – 网络

时间:2018-10-25 04:22:06

相关推荐

C语言字符串读取(详解C语言中字符串的输入和读取方法) – 网络

ff()函数可以使用%s格式符,f(“%s”, str);

ff()函数只能读取一个单词,也就是遇到空格或者换行符就会停止读取。

2. gets()函数读取字符串

gets()函数也是C语言中常用的输入函数,它可以读取一行字符串,

gets(str);

在上面的代码中,gets()函数会读取用户输入的一行字符串,并将其存储在str数组中。需要注意的是,gets()函数不会检查输入的字符串长度,如果输入的字符串超过了数组的大小,就会导致程序崩溃。

3. fgets()函数读取字符串

fgets()函数是C语言中比较安全的字符串读取函数,它可以读取一行字符串,并限制输入的长度,);

表示从标准输入读取数据。

f()函数读取带空格的字符串

ff()函数配合%c格式符,f]”, str); // 读取一行字符串,直到遇到换行符为止

f()函数读取完字符串后,换行符会留在输入缓冲区中,如果后面还要读取其他数据,需要先清空输入缓冲区。

f()函数、gets()函数和fgets()函数等。对于不同的应用场景,可以选择不同的方法来读取字符串。需要注意的是,在读取字符串时,要注意输入的长度和格式,避免程序崩溃。

本内容不代表本网观点和政治立场,如有侵犯你的权益请联系我们处理。
网友评论
网友评论仅供其表达个人看法,并不表明网站立场。